"Giants of the Organ in Concert" is a legendary live album that captures the electrifying energy of Jimmy McGriff and Groove Holmes, two titans of the jazz organ scene, performing together in Boston in 1973. Originally released in 1974, this album has been remastered for 2024, offering a crisp and vibrant listening experience that stays true to the raw power of the original performance.
The album is a masterclass in jazz-funk, soul jazz, hard bop, and jazz blues, showcasing the incredible chemistry between McGriff and Holmes. Each track is a testament to their virtuosity, with standout performances like "The Preachers Tune" and "Closing Time" highlighting their ability to blend soulful melodies with hard-hitting rhythms.
